8.5.16 Patapsco River Watershed Cleanup at Daniel's Dam

Patapsco Heritage Greenway sponsored a watershed cleanup along a section of the Patapsco River in partnership with UMBC in Ellicott City on Friday, August 5, 2016. This section of the Pataspco River is just above and below Daniels Dam and has a wide path surrounded by thick woods and vegation. The day wasn't too hot with temps in the 80's and a cloudy sky. Around 50 volunteers from UMBC helped remove 375 pounds of trash and junk from this area of the Patapsco River.

The items we removed were primarily picnic trash like paper plates, disposable cups, beer bottles, dirty diapers, and water melon rinds. We also found some flip flops and a pair of Nike shoes.
